Wildfire Safety Expo

The Mendocino County Fire Safe Council took advantage of this excellent opportunity to host a Wildfire Safety Expo concurrent with the Homebrew Festival. The Wildfire Safety Expo was free and open to all, including children! Stay tuned for details about the 2023 event!

Attendees had the chance to speak with and learn from local neighborhood Fire Safe Councils, fire departments and other first responders, local public and private organizations, and firewise service providers. There were live fire demonstrations, children’s’ activities, and free giveaways throughout the afternoon.
